Detailed Solution

(1)    Numbers formed using 0, 1, 2, 3, 4

(2)    Lie between 2000 and 5000

(3)    Multiple of 3

Case i   using  0, 1, 2, 3

             Number of 4 digit numbers between 2000, 5000 divisible by 3 =2×3! 

2 or 3   

Case ii   using  0, 2, 3, 4

                Number of 4 digit number b/w 2000, 5000 divisible by 3 is 3×3!

 

2, 3, 4   

               Total number of numbers b/w 2000, 5000 divisible by  3=2×3!+3×3!=5(3!)=30
